Call for submissions:

Asymptote (http://www.asymptotejournal.com/), an international journal of
literature in translation, is currently looking for exciting work for our
upcoming July 2013 issue (submissions deadline June 15). We publish poetry,
fiction, nonfiction, criticism, visual art, and drama, and would
particularly welcome submissions on the nonfiction and criticism fronts, as
well as essays introducing unfamiliar but relevant authors who work outside
of English to an English speaking audience. In addition, we're looking for
submissions for a special drama feature on self-translation, ex-patriation,
and the theatre. All guidelines can be found here: http://
www.asymptotejournal.com/submit.php.

Our goal as a journal is to create encounters between different voices and
to bring exciting literature from all over the globe for free to a wide
audience. Whenever possible, we try to publish translators' notes and MP3s
of the author or someone else reading his/her work in the original. Thank
you for considering our journal as a landing place for your work. We look
forward to carefully considering whatever you send our way.
